Tom Ryan is the head wrestling coach at Ohio State University. As head coach at Hofstra University, he led his team to top-10 rankings in NCAA Division 1-A in each of the past nine seasons. He lives in Ohio.
Julie Sampson is a sports writer whose work has been published in the New York Times and Newsday. She lives in Northport, New York.

Coach Tom Ryan gives you winning drills from his playbook to improve your team's speed, power, and coordination. Also included are essays by powerhouse coaches, champion wrestlers, and former competitors that will show you how to build a solid team and motivate young athletes, teach the fundamentals, and use drills to improve speed, power, and coordination.
Legendary coach and wrestler Dan Gable shows you how to gain toughness and strength from the rigors of wrestling; U.S. Secretary of Defense Donald Rumsfeld explains how he used the challenge and discipline of the sport to propel himself into positions of power; and Olympic gold medalist Ben Peterson gives you tips on how to surround yourself with supportive people.
